Britain promised to help safeguard Japanese troops engaged in a non-combat mission in southern Iraq if the Netherlands ends its deployment. The promise was made when Defense Secretary Geoff Hoon met his Japanese counterpart Shigeru Ishiba, officials said Tuesday. The Netherlands plans to withdraw its troops in March next year from the Iraqi city of Samawa where Japan has been engaged in humanitarian and reconstruction acitivities since late last year.Full Story
